Structural Innovation: The Double Eccentric Advantage

This valve's defining attribute is its double offset geometry. not like regular butterfly valves, its axis of rotation is offset twice: from your pipeline center and once more in the valve seat center. This creates a cam-like motion. given that the valve opens, the disc right away lifts with the seat, removing friction and use typical in concentric patterns. When closing, the disc contacts the seat only at the ultimate instant, guaranteeing a decent seal with no compressive strain or rubbing. This appreciably extends sealing aspect existence and ensures secure, very long-expression integrity.

1. what's the primary distinction between a double eccentric as well as a concentric butterfly valve?

A concentric butterfly valve incorporates a stem that passes from the centerline in the disc, which is centered within the pipe bore. This structure results in the disc edge to get in frequent contact with the seat, leading to friction and wear. A double eccentric valve has two offsets that move the disc far from the seat because it opens, making a cam action that removes rubbing and drastically extends the life of the seal.

2. Are double eccentric butterfly valves suited to handling sludge together with other abrasive media?

Certainly, They are really really well suited for this sort of programs. The mixture of a long lasting metallic seat as well as the non-friction opening and shutting mechanism tends to make them way more immune to the abrasive and corrosive nature of sludge than standard smooth-seated valves. This tends to make them ideal for Most important sludge lines, digested sludge transfer, and dewatering procedures.
